Vénissieux: David Bellanger, new director of the Usin project
Since the start of the school year in September, the Usin project, in Vénissieux, has a new director in the person of David Bellanger. This trained engineer replaced Audrey Delaloy, who had held this position since the end of 2019. “My role is to lead the team that operates the site and ensure its development”, describes David Bellanger.
Usin Lyon Parilly is an 11 ha site, located in the heart of the city. It was sought by the SERL (Company of equipment and development of the Rhône and Lyon) and the Metropolis to set up innovative factories. Among its tenants, we can cite Symbio, manufacturer of hydrogen fuel cells, Boostheat, manufacturer of ecological boilers and Bosch Rexroth.
Today, 92% of the 30,000 m² of premises are occupied. Another 30,000 square meters will soon emerge, the first 10,000 by 2023.
A team of eight people
The role of David Bellanger and his team consists in particular in finding the right tenants and offering them a suitable real estate offer. “To do this, you have to understand their activity, their process. It is very enriching intellectually”, says David Bellanger.
The latter can use his 17 years of experience within the SERL as director of urban development projects and public facilities to carry out his mission. Previously, this engineer from INSA worked for a few years for the OPAC du Rhône.
“What I like about these new functions is the great freedom of execution that we enjoy”, explains David Bellanger, who manages a team of eight people.
